No Girl Needs a Husband Seven Days a Week

Nina Foxx

2007 · EN

A husband can be good for a number of things:Companionship (when he's home)Household repairs (if he's handy)Good loving (if you're lucky), but...no girl needs a husband seven days a week!Marie needs her "stay-at-home husband" to clean the house and babysit the kids, so she can take care of business coast-to-coast...and enjoy some harmless flirting on the side.Mai's perfectly content to be the perfect wife to a successful corporate superstar—throwing lavish parties and organizing gala charity fundraisers. But it's funny how quickly everything can change with just a single phone call...from prison!And high-powered ad exec Kennedy believes the best husband is no husband at all. Hot encounters with a succession of studs keep her going strong as she climbs to the top of her profession.A spouse is fine as long as he doesn't screw up the rest of your life. Now three lovely ladies who think they have this "husband" thing all worked out are about to learn that, when it comes to love and marriage, "perfection" can always be improved upon. And it's going to be one wild ride!
